Because right after I wrote my first article for the Salt Lake Tribune on
Ferrets and began U.F.O.  a lady called me and asked me if I would take her
ferret.  I could not say no, because she said if I didn't she was going to
have to let it go.  This was in November, its cold here at that time of
year.  So I gave her my home address and within an hour she dropped off a
one year old silver mitt.  I did not have extra room for him.  I had two
ferrets at the time and I was not sure they would get along.  Well, this
ferret was a royal pain in the butt.  He kept escaping my cage and getting
into all kinds of mischief.  He stole anything and everything.  After about
two weeks another telephone call and two more arrived, then another one,
and another one, and another one.  Finally, I had to do something and we
began a shelter and finding homes for these critters and we have not been
able to stop since.  My ferret family has grown to eight and that is our
limit.
